Last Matches & H2H
Juventus had five shots on target when they drew 1-1 with Bologna at Stadio Renato Dell'Ara. Arkadiusz Milik found the net during this Serie A match.
Lecce´s previous match was a 1-0 win against Udinese at Stadio Via del Mare. They had three shots on target and seven corners in the Serie A match, with Gabriel Strefezza on the scoresheet.
Juventus won against Lecce by a 1-0 scoreline when the teams last met at Stadio Via del Mare.
In the past 3 encounters, we have seen Juventus win two times and Lecce land no victories. The other clash between the teams was a draw.
